Shoulders of the tire wear to a point that there are no longer any sipes even though there is plenty of siped- tread remaining in the center of the tire; thus, water is not displaced as well, creating a greater chance of hydroplaning.

Incredibly long tread life - over 90,000 miles on this set. Great in rain until about 85,000 miles. Still not down to the TWI's yet. Quiet and comfortable ride as well.

100,000 miles and counting, great ride, handling and traction. I was caught in snow storm 7 months ago and drove through 6 inches of snow even with 90,000 miles on them. With 100,000 still good traction in Portland, Oregon rain.
